Sha256: 66a65f29fbd31cad126e04c166918c0fe75b3f7e51fd4322f47633207f29f335
Contents?: true
Size: 430 Bytes
Versions: 1
Compression:
Stored size: 430 Bytes
Contents
module Daijobu module Adapter class TokyoCabinetAdapter def initialize(store) @store = store end def get(*keys) if keys.size == 0 nil elsif keys.size == 1 @store[keys.first] else @store.lget(keys) end end def set(key, value) @store[key] = value end end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
sander6-daijobu-0.2.0 | lib/daijobu/adapters/tokyo_cabinet.rb |